How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bucks County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bucks County Studio Apartments | $1,588 | $980 | $2,995 |
Bucks County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,085 | $859 | $3,593 |
Bucks County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,725 | $1,159 | $4,864 |
Bucks County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,916 | $1,500 | $4,600 |
Bucks County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,779 | $2,779 | $2,779 |
